The Psychological Factors Driving Engagement

Beyond the simple mechanics and addictive gameplay, the chicken road game taps into several fundamental psychological factors. The feeling of control, albeit limited, over a chaotic situation is inherently satisfying. Players relish the challenge of navigating the chicken through the oncoming traffic, making split-second decisions that determine its fate. The near misses and successful crossings trigger the release of dopamine, creating a pleasurable sensation that reinforces the behavior. The game also utilizes the principle of variable ratio reinforcement – rewards are given out at unpredictable intervals, making the experience more captivating and preventing players from becoming bored. These psychological mechanisms work together to create a highly addictive and engaging gaming experience.
